In 'The Five Boons of Life', Mark Twain uses a fable - like style. The story is about different 'boons' or gifts that life can offer. Each boon represents a different aspect of human desires and experiences. For example, one of the boons might be related to wealth or power. Through this short story, Twain comments on human nature and how people often pursue these things without fully understanding the consequences or true value.
